Freight forwarders: The hidden power behind the logistics industry

Freight forwarders: The hidden power behind the logistics industry In today's interconnected world, globalization propels the rapid surge in international commerce and the advancement of the global economy. Those who seamlessly facilitate the movement of goods and materials across international borders act as unsung champions, underpinning the mechanics of global trade. Among these champions, Freight Forwarders stand out, undertaking a pivotal role in this global exchange.

Freight Forwarders are specialized firms providing transportation, customs handling, warehousing, and logistics services. They can be envisaged as the orchestrators of global trade. Many businesses and individuals rely on these experts to steer through the intricate logistical challenges they confront in their overseas trading activities.

The Role and Functions of Freight Forwarders

At the heart of a Freight Forwarder's role is organizing the entirety of the logistic processes to ensure goods are delivered from the sender (importer) to the recipient (exporter). This comprehensive process encompasses arranging the freight according to various transportation modes like road, sea, air, or rail. Simultaneously, they guide their clients through customs, legal procedures, insurance undertakings, and storage phases.

Freight Forwarders present their clients with manifold benefits. Given the intricacies of global shipping operations, the expertise of a proficient Freight Forwarder translates to considerable time and energy savings for clients. Moreover, these specialists can enhance efficiency by optimizing clients' shipping costs.

A dependable Freight Forwarder provides clients with transparent and timely tracking information, ensuring they remain updated about their shipments' status. This transparency enables clients to promptly address any arising issues.

Managing Risks and Overcoming Challenges

An intrinsic role of Freight Forwarders is risk mitigation and problem-solving throughout the transportation sequence. They adeptly address unforeseen challenges commonly encountered in global trade, such as customs complications, shipping delays, damaged, or lost consignments. Their extensive experience and proficiency enable them to devise effective solutions in such situations.

Additionally, by closely monitoring international shipping regulations and customs directives, they can apprise their clients, ensuring compliance and foresight in potential legal obligations.

Why Should Companies Collaborate with a Freight Forwarder? Engaging with a Freight Forwarder offers companies a slew of significant advantages. Here are reasons elucidating the necessity and benefits of partnering with a Freight Forwarder:
  • Logistics and Expertise Freight Forwarders are seasoned professionals specializing in logistical and transportation processes. Companies can leverage their expertise, ensuring time and resource savings when grappling with complex undertakings like international shipping and customs operations.
  • Global Network and Connections Boasting an expansive global network, Freight Forwarders establish robust ties with suppliers, logistics operators, and customs officials in various countries. This positions companies to maneuver more efficiently and effectively in their international trade ventures.
  • Cost Optimization Freight Forwarders assist in honing shipping costs. By considering factors like bulk transportation, suitable routes, and transportation modalities, they aid companies in curtailing their shipping expenditures.
  • Customs Procedures and Regulations The labyrinthine nature of customs processes in international trade, differing across countries, can be daunting. Freight Forwarders steer companies through these customs operations, ensuring conformity and legality in import and export activities.
  • Risk Management Equipped with experience in circumventing potential pitfalls in the transportation process, Freight Forwarders can adeptly handle unexpected challenges, like damaged or lost shipments and transport delays.
  • Tracking and Monitoring Freight Forwarders empower companies with continuous shipment tracking, offering real-time updates. This ensures clients are always informed about their shipment status and can intervene when necessary.
  • Time and Energy Efficiency Freight Forwarders enable companies to economize on time and energy by handling their logistical operations, allowing firms to center their focus on core activities.
  • Professional Consultancy Freight Forwarders extend professional consultation services to clients. By updating them on current shifts and novelties in international trade, they bolster companies in enhancing their commercial endeavors.
